Neighborhood Overview
New City Academy is situated in Lansing, Michigan, a city rich in history and state government functions. The academy is located on the southwest side of Lansing, accessible via major roadways like W. Holmes Road and near I-96 and US-127, providing straightforward access from various points in the region. The nearest major airport is Lansing Capital Region International Airport (LAN), approximately a 15-20 minute drive north, depending on traffic. For those arriving by car, the immediate area around the academy offers surface parking lots. Public transportation options include Capital Area Transportation Authority (CATA) bus routes that serve the surrounding neighborhoods, offering an alternative to driving. Smart arrival tactics involve checking local traffic reports, especially during peak school hours or event times, and allowing a buffer of 15-20 minutes for parking and walking to your destination within the academy complex.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ter in Lansing can be quite cold, with average temperatures often below freezing. Expect snow, ice, and chilly winds that necessitate warm, waterproof clothing, including heavy coats, hats, gloves, and sturdy boots. Travel to and from New City Academy may be affected by snow accumulation, so allow extra time and check road conditions. Indoor activities and warm-up spaces are highly valued during these months.
Spring & early summer
Spring brings a gradual warming trend, though temperatures can fluctuate significantly. Rain is common, with occasional thunderstorms developing. Visitors should pack layers, including a light jacket or sweater and an umbrella or raincoat. Outdoor spaces begin to become more inviting, but rain can still impact field conditions or outdoor event plans. Late spring can offer pleasant, mild weather.
Mid-summer
Mid-summer in Lansing typically features warm to hot temperatures, with daytime highs frequently in the 80s and sometimes reaching the 90s Fahrenheit. Humidity can make it feel warmer. Light clothing, sunscreen, and staying hydrated are essential. Shaded areas at the academy or indoor spaces become crucial during the hottest parts of the day. Evening events are often the most comfortable during peak summer.
Fall season
Fall offers crisp, cool air and beautiful autumn colors, with temperatures gradually decreasing through September, October, and November. Layers are key, including sweaters, light jackets, and perhaps a warmer coat as the season progresses. Rain is still a possibility, and the first snowfalls can occur late in the season. Outdoor activities are very pleasant in early fall, but indoor comforts are welcome by late fall.
Rain & snow
Rain is a frequent visitor to Lansing throughout the year, especially in spring and fall. Always be prepared with an umbrella or waterproof jacket. Snow is common from late November through March, ranging from light dustings to significant accumulations. Snowfall can impact travel significantly, leading to potential delays or cancellations for events and requiring caution on roads and sidewalks.
